While the dish is cooking, a [[notes|sleep tip]] will be displayed at the bottom of the screen. The player can tap the screen to speed up the rate of cooking, with more taps required when there are more ingredients in the pot. Occasionally, an exclamation mark will appear above the pot at the end of cooking; this indicates that the dish is "extra tasty", meaning that the dish's strength will be much greater than usual. The exact probability of a dish being extra tasty is unknown, but it is 20% more likely to occur on Sunday.

The strength of the dish is calculated by summing up the current strength of the recipe and the base strengths of all the ingredients added to the pot that are not included in the recipe. This is then multiplied by the player's area bonus for the current research area and rounded down to get the final strength. If the dish is extra tasty on Monday-Saturday, the final strength will be doubled. If the dish is extra tasty on Sunday, the final strength will be tripled. The chance for a dish to be extra tasty can be progressively increased up to 70% by using the {{sleep|skill}} Tasty Chance S and upon a successful extra tasty cook, the chance will be reset back to the base level for that day.


When a recipe is cooked, the number of strength it yields will go towards levelling up that recipe. The higher a recipe's level is, the more strength it will innately yield. The current level cap for recipes is 55.
When a recipe is cooked, the number of strength it yields will go towards levelling up that recipe. The higher a recipe's level is, the more strength it will innately yield. The current level cap for recipes is 55.
